Background Default color - 4/12/2000 14:25:00
Did you know that if you leave the background color at default it will be whatever color the user has specified as his or her default? Yep, IE is white "out of the box" and NN is grey. Most users never change it so we assume it's whatever browser we use. One of the very first rules for young web designers is always set ALL body attributes (bgcolor, text, link, alink, and vlink) on every page before you ever write the first line of code.
